.S. stocks finished slightly higher as traders assessed a round of corporate deals and a recent spike in oil prices brought on by the conflict in Iraq. Indexes moved between small gains and losses for much of the day before eking out a slight gain for the second trading day in a row.
The Dow Jones industrial average rose 5.27 points, or 0.03 percent, to 16,781.01.
The Standard & Poor's 500 index gained 1.62, less than 0.1 percent, to close at 1,937.78.
The Nasdaq composite index rose 10.45 points, or 0.2 percent, to 4,321.11.
For the year:
The Dow is up 204.35 points, or 1.2 percent.
The S&P 500 index is up 89.42 points, or 4.8 percent.
The Nasdaq is up 144.52 points, or 3.5 percent. (***)
